Transaction 32617f41760af41fbd9e04592393f37402331157c6ce1c5f6e6587bbea08241e

1 Input
2 Outputs
  • 32617f41760af41fbd9e04592393f37402331157c6ce1c5f6e6587bbea08241e:0
  • value  26747179
    address  1BCRazHSDmhFNxuiUki4J7oRV7Dy1EWLnz
  • 32617f41760af41fbd9e04592393f37402331157c6ce1c5f6e6587bbea08241e:1
  • value  567841
    address  bc1qmwytplvqlwcxuag8dpywxv595rxslr5t4wf9gr